16. PRIVACY.

16.1. Information Collected. The Software collects network, performance, and usage information from licensed devices within an End-User’s mobile deployment. The types of personally identifiable information collected vary by the type of device and may include but are not limited to device names, logged-in user name, phone number, adapter serial number, and application names, correlated with location information. The information is collected from each licensed device and transmitted via a secure connection to the respective Software server, using an SSL and/or VPN connection, as placed in service and configured by the End-User's Software administrator.

16.2. Your Use of Information Collected. You understand the Software is capable of permitting you to use the information identified in Section 16.1 to determine when and where a device has been used, and may also be used to display maps that show traces, coverage, connections, network performance and other collected information plotted for one or more devices during a specified timeperiod. You further understand and acknowledge that licensed devices contribute information that are individually identifiable and that correspond to the actual date and time of data generation, enabling review and analysis of collected information.

16.3. Privacy and Access to the Information. Access to personally identifiable information collected and stored in the Software is only by authorized users via log-in controlled by user-name and password. User-name and password accounts are established by End-User’s Software administrator(s). PDF files, KML location files, and image files containing personally identifiable information and map information can be configured, exported and saved by an authorized Software user or administrator. These features are provided by the Software to allow End-Users to analyze, document and archive the information. These files contain no inherent encryption and contain personally identifiable information and you agree to take reasonable precautions to properly secure the personally identifiable information in accordance with End-User’s privacy information policies and applicable state and federal laws.

16.4. Privacy and commitment to security. The Software employs physical, electronic, and administrative controls to enable End-Users to safeguard and prevent unauthorized access to the information collected.
